Re. 4BC holding its ground, what you're missing is that 4BC has consistently hovered a point either side of 5% (10+) since Fairfax/MRN removed nearly all the local staff.
17 hours local radio out of 168 hours in a week or 10.11% local is disrespectful to any market purporting to be serious talkback.
The result looks poor, is low on cost, seemingly the only thing MRN worry of.
4BC will never improve until local programs are invested and the station regains the respect of Brisbane.
